Incorporating tangible elements into your sporting business name can add depth and authenticity to your brand. This involves integrating specific terminology or references that relate directly to the sport you’re focused on. For instance, if your business is centered around soccer, names that include terms like ‘kick’, ‘goal’, or’strike’ could be effective. Such elements not only make the name sport-specific but also can appeal to an audience that has a deep-rooted connection with the sport.Choosing a name that incorporates tangible elements ensures that your brand is immediately recognizable to your target audience. It demonstrates an understanding of the sport’s terminology and culture, which can be especially appealing to dedicated fans and athletes.
Should my business name reflect the sport I am involved in?
Yes, incorporating sport-specific terminology into your business name can enhance authenticity and relatability to your target audience. However, ensure that the name remains broad enough to avoid alienating potential customers outside the specific sport's fan base.
Is it better to have a simple or complex sporting business name?
It is generally better to opt for a simple, memorable, and easy-to-spell name. Simplicity aids in recall and sharing, making it easier for potential customers to remember and recommend your business.
